J.R. Haynie

J.R. is an oral surgeon and a proud product of Brigham City. Along the way, he has earned an impressive collection of alma maters: Box Elder High School, Snow College, Utah State University, The Ohio State University, and Indiana University—making him a Bee, Badger, Aggie, Buckeye, and Hoosier. Married for 23 years, he returned to the Pickleville stage as a Pirate Ancestor, proving once again that some things can’t be kept buried… including memories of when he proposed to his wife right here on this very stage. He always suspected she might be a witch, because from the very first time he saw her, she had him completely under her spell. Together, they’ve raised four kids—three boys and one very clearly favorite daughter, Lucy—who dreams of becoming a singer someday. He loves golf, ultimate frisbee, and occasionally confusing his teens with outdated slang like “Skibidi” and “Six Seven,” much to their horror and amusement. J.R. lives by a simple motto: Live on Purpose. He finds humor, joy, and a little chaos everywhere—from the stage to the golf course to the family dinner table—and always has a story ready to tell. He has a zero-tolerance policy for cheating in board games or cards, and an unshakable hatred of pickles—two things he takes very seriously.

Trevor Jones

Trevor graduated from Utah State University this spring with a Bachelor’s degree in Integrated Studies and an Audio Technology Certificate. Over the summer, he worked for the Lyric Repertory Company as an A1, and he also enjoyed doing sound for the Laub Plaza community concert series in Logan. His favorite part of working in theatre is getting to put on a show for a new audience every night.

Taylor Seth Hall

He’s back for his TENTH production with Pickleville! Taylor grew up in Cedar City, Utah, and was trained in acting at Southern Utah University. When not on stage, he is an audiobook narrator for Storytime Classics Audio. Taylor also enjoys anything and everything related to Doctor Who, and if you get to know him, you’ll find that out very quickly.

Angie Call

Angie is thrilled to be back at Pickleville with this amazing cast!   Some of her favorite roles include The Narrator in Joseph...Dreamcoat, Fiona in Shrek, Mother in Ragtime, Mrs. Banks in Mary Poppins, Sour Kangaroo in Seussical,  Pheobe in Gentleman's Guide, and Adelaide in Guys and Dolls.  She is the music director for the Juniors in the Academy at Centerpoint Theatre.  She is especially happy to once again be sharing the stage with her husband, Dan.

Alexis Lilya

After graduating from USU with a degree in theatrical lighting design, Alexis now works for the King Fine Arts Center as an Assistant Technical Director. It keeps her busy running everything from dance recitals to band concerts to full musicals. She loves all the involvement and getting to do events for her community.

There is nothing like spending fall in Bear Lake and Alexis is thrilled to be back for her third fall production; although, this is her first time joining in the Addam's Family tradition!

When not in the theater, Alexis can be found cooking new recipes, playing video games, and snuggling her cat, Piper.
